Pricing/Valuation Process
It's simple to value your portfolio through PMH Financial. Just open and save the attached Excel® template, fill it out, or easier still, copy and paste the information from your servicing files, then e-mail the completed file to notes@pmhfinancial.com . As you will see on the template, the following information is required.

  • Borrower name.
  • Credit Score.
  • Collateral address and park name, if any.
  • Model year.
  • Collateral dimensions. ( Length and Width)
  • Original and current balances.
  • Sales price and down payment.
  • First, paid to, and next payment dates.
  • Original term of note. (In months).
  • Maturity date and dated date of note.
  • Monthly principal in interest payment amount.
  • Note interest rate.
  • Payment history. (Times late 30, 60, and 90 days)

General Note Parameters

  • Note cannot exceed 40 years from the manufacture date of the underlying collateral.
  • Collateral no older than the 1976 model year.
  • Maximum term of note cannot exceed 15 years.
